Solution Overview
Problem
Smart dressing mirrors in clothing stores primarily offer virtual try-on capabilities, lacking the ability to provide accurate and personalized clothing recommendations based on user preferences, leading to a monotonous user experience and reduced engagement.
Innovation Solution
An information processing method and apparatus that utilizes a dressing mirror to detect user operations, capture images, and transmit them to a server for analysis, generating recommendation information based on user preferences, which is then displayed back to the user, establishing an association between the server and client to enhance user interaction and improve recommendation accuracy.

An information processing method and device based on clothes trying on are disclosed. The method includes the following. Clothes is displayed by a dressing mirror based on clothes information. A user operation is detected by the dressing mirror during displaying the clothes. In a case of detecting that a user operation is a photographing operation, in response to the photographing operation, an image is captured and the captured image is transmitted to a first client through a server. In a case that the server generates recommendation information based on the captured image, the recommendation information is acquired by the dressing mirror from the server and the clothes is displayed based on the recommendation information.
